🛒 Ingredients (1 serving)
- Egg whites4 large (120ml)
- Spinach (fresh)60g
- Cherry tomatoes60g
- Cooking spray or ½ tsp olive oilminimal
- Salt and pepperto taste
- Dried herbs (oregano or chives)½ tsp
👨🍳 Instructions
- 1Separate egg whites from yolks. Season egg whites with salt, pepper and herbs. Whisk until slightly frothy.💡 Room temperature egg whites whisk more easily and create a fluffier omelette.
- 2Sauté spinach in a separate pan (or microwave 30 seconds) until wilted. Halve cherry tomatoes.
- 3Heat a non-stick pan over medium heat. Spray with cooking spray or add ½ tsp oil.
- 4Pour in egg whites. Let edges set (about 1 minute), then gently lift edges with a spatula and tilt the pan to let uncooked egg white flow underneath.
- 5When surface is just barely set (not fully dry), add spinach and tomatoes to one half. Fold the other half over. Slide onto a plate and serve immediately.
Frequently asked questions
How many calories in an egg white omelette?
4 egg whites with spinach and tomatoes: approximately 130 kcal, 22g protein, 4g carbs and 2g fat. With 30g feta cheese added: approximately 250 kcal, 30g protein.
Is egg white omelette good for weight loss?
Yes — an egg white omelette is one of the lowest-calorie, highest-protein breakfast options. 130 kcal with 22g protein makes it extremely efficient for weight loss.
How much protein in egg white omelette?
4 egg whites provide approximately 18g protein. The full omelette with vegetables totals approximately 22g protein at only 130 kcal.
Egg white vs whole egg omelette — calories?
2 whole eggs: approximately 220 kcal, 14g protein. 4 egg whites: approximately 130 kcal, 22g protein. Egg whites provide more protein at fewer calories, but whole eggs contain fat-soluble vitamins and healthy fats.
Should I use whole eggs or egg whites?
For weight loss: egg whites are more efficient (more protein per calorie). For general health: whole eggs provide vitamins A, D, E, K and choline in the yolk. Many people use 2 whole eggs + 2 egg whites for balance.
Is egg white omelette keto?
Yes — only 4g carbs per serving, 22g protein and 2g fat. For keto, add cheese or avocado to increase fat content.
